Which of these is not a macromolecule?

  1. Cellulose

  2. DNA

  3. Glycogen

  4. None of the above

Reveal answer Fill a bubble to check yourself
D Correct answer
Explanation

Macromolecules are the molecules made by the attachment of micro molecule. These are complex molecules. Cellulose, DNA, and glycogen are macromolecules as they are formed by linkage of simple monomers.

Cellulose is a polysaccharide. It is formed by the linkage of beta 1,4 linkage of a glucose unit. It is an important component of the cell wall of the plant.
DNA and RNA are the chain of polynucleotide which are joined by the phosphodiester bonds.
Glycogen is a polymer of glucose. It's the structure similar to amylopectin where two polymeric chains of glucose of alpha 1,4 glucose unit are linked by alpha 1,6 linkage.
So, the correct answer is option D.

R.Q. is less than one at the time of respiration of

  1. Starch

  2. Sugarcane

  3. Glucose

  4. Groundnut

Reveal answer Fill a bubble to check yourself
D Correct answer
Explanation

Respiratory quotient or R.Q is defined as the ratio of carbon dioxide evolved to oxygen taken in for respiratory break down of a substrate. The value of R.Q for oxidation of carbohydrates is unity and less than one for oxidation of fats and proteins. Thus if groundnut, which stores fats is used as respiratory substrate the value of R.Q will be less than one.

During strenuous exercise, glucose is converted into

  1. Glycogen

  2. Pyruvic acid

  3. Starch

  4. Lactic acid

Reveal answer Fill a bubble to check yourself
D Correct answer
Explanation

Generally, the glucose undergoes metabolism in the presence of oxygen to form ATP(adenosine triphosphate) which is essential for the muscle contraction but during strenuous exercise, the body cannot meet the oxygen demand and the glucose undergoes metabolism in the absence of oxygen which results in the formation and accumulation of lactic acid.Hence during strenuous exercise,glucose is converted into lactic acid.

So,the correct answer is 'Lactic acid'.

 Plants use polymers of glucose as storage molecules and as structural components in their cell walls. Which of the following polysaccharides would be found in a plant?
 I. Starch
 II. Glycogen
 III. Cellulose

  1. I only

  2. II only

  3. III only

  4. I and II only

  5. I and III only

Reveal answer Fill a bubble to check yourself
E Correct answer
Explanation

Cellulose forms an integral part of the cell wall which provides strength and rigidity to the cell. It helps to maintain the structural integrity of a particular cell. Cellulose is a complex polysaccharide which is made up of  β(1→4) linked D-glucose units.

Starch is the important food reserve for the plants. The excess amount of glucose synthesized during dark reaction of photosynthesis is stored in food vacuoles of the plant which it again converted into a usable form of glucose in case of unfavorable conditions. It is a complex polysaccharide formed by 1,4-alpha linkage between two glucose unit.
So, the correct answer is option E.
